“Hi MFJ, can you do a feature of this bag with price? Thanks!”
- April, Manila, Philippines
The moment I saw the Prada Perforated Saffiano Tote, I knew I had to share it with you. I definitely see this as a classy bag for Spring. It’s a shopping tote but it looks just as classy as any other leather hobo or medium bag. It doesn’t deserve to be a shopper but a bag to match a flowing floral maxi dress or a tie dye skirt… the Spring fashion… the works!
For $1,350, the Prada Perforated Saffiano tote comes with a gold hardware, shoulder straps with rings, a magnetic closure, and best of all… a detachable zip pouch! I love it! The size of this bag is 12 9/10″H x 14″W x 5 9/10″. And of course, this bag is made in Italy. I love it! This bag comes in three colors. I love this camel color below.

This one I am so excited to share with you. Actually, I already went to Louis Vuitton last weekend to check it out – the latest wallet and affordable at that, the Louis Vuitton Josephine wallet. I was quite hesitant at first… thinking that the buttons were colored. So I decided to go to my fave LV boutique to see what it’s really like in real life. It was not bad at all. In fact, the red was already sold out at the main LV boutique. However I saw the red one in another style, the Emilie wallet, which I will share with you soon. When I went to the LV store inside Neiman’s though, they have the Josephine wallet in red and well, it’s still available online.
What’s even interesting about the Louis Vuitton Josephine wallet is that the coin pouch is removable. You can just take it with you if you’re on the run or you’re carrying a clutch. It’s like a flat pencil case. I won’t be taking it out though because that compartment alone looks cheap. But so what, it really is cheap compared to the $600-700 wallets that Louis Vuitton has. But needless to say, I’m already loving this wallet. It’s not as pretty as the other expensive wallets from Louis Vuitton but what made me love it even more is the price.
